Re: AbstractSelectModel is not in a controlled package

2010-01-25 Thread Piero Sartini
but the article you sent me is exactly the same article I used before!!! I just dont get why tapestry complaints about its own class AbstractSelectModel... Because you extended it. I assume your GenericSelectionModel sits in a controlled package: base, components, or one of the others. This

Re: AbstractSelectModel is not in a controlled package

2010-01-25 Thread Piero Sartini
Forget about what I said. Just needed to do the same thing, and the packaging is: InjectSelectionModel outside of any controlled package, for example: your.app.package.annotations GenericSelectionModel inside a controlled package, ie your.app.package.base InjectSelectionModelWorker inside
